Bala Cynwyd Shopping Center
Strategically located along the vibrant City Avenue corridor—just steps from SEPTA’s Cynwyd Line and minutes from downtown Philadelphia—Bala Cynwyd Shopping Center stands at the crossroads of convenience and connection. With a strong tenant mix and high visibility, the center has long been a cornerstone of daily life for residents and commuters alike.
BCT Design Group partnered with Federal Realty Investment Trust to lead a multi-million-dollar transformation, turning the 23-acre site into a refreshed and future-ready retail environment. Our work redefined the center’s public realm, introducing new outdoor dining areas, community gathering spaces, and enhanced streetscapes that invite people to linger, engage, and enjoy. Upgraded landscaping and thoughtful site planning contribute to a more walkable, welcoming experience throughout the 174,000-square-foot retail destination.
